How To Prepare Dandelion Bundt Cake Recipe?

Prep: 30 mins

Cook: 55 mins

Total: 1 hr 25 mins

Serves: 10-12

Equipment Needed

  • Bundt pan
  • Mixing bowls
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Whisk
  • Spatula
  • Toothpick

Ingredients:

For the cake:

  • 2¼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1½ cups gran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• 3 large eggs
  • ½ cup olive oil
  • 1 stick (8 ounces) unsalted butter, melted
  • 1¼ cups whole milk
  • ¼ cup lemon juice
  • Zest of 1 lemon
  • ¼ cup St-Germain (optional)
  • 1 cup packed dandelion petals

For the glaze:

  • 2 cups confectioners’ sugar
  • 2 tablespoons St-Germain or lemon juice
  • Water, as needed

Instructions By Dandelion Cake Recipe:

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ease and flour a Bundt pan.

In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, salt, baking soda, and baking powder. Set aside.

In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, olive oil, melted butter, lemon juice, lemon zest, St-Germain (if using), and milk.

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and whisk until just combined.

Gently fold in the dandelion petals.

Pour the batter into the prepared Bundt pan and bake for 50-60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before inverting it onto a wire rack to cool completely.

To make the glaze, whisk together the confectioners’ sugar, St-Germain or lemon juice, and water until smooth. Drizzle the glaze over the cooled cake.

Tips and Variations

  • For a more intense dandelion flavor, use more dandelion petals.
  • You can also add other edible flowers to the cake, such as violets or pansies.
  • If you don’t have St-Germain, you can use lemon juice or milk instead.
  • To make a dairy-free cake, use soy milk or almond milk instead of whole milk.

Do Dandelions Have Medicinal Properties?

Many people consider dandelion as a detoxifying and cleansing herb. It was called ‘piss-a-bed’ in the early nineteenth century because of its diuretic properties.

Dandelion leaves, roots, and flowers can all be used to cure various illnesses.

In the middle ages, dandelion was thought to be good for curing kidney stones, dropsy, and other diseases that involved fluid retention.
